The North America HVDC (High Voltage Direct Current) Wall Bushings market is segmented by application into several key subsegments. In the realm of Power Transmission, HVDC wall bushings play a crucial role in facilitating efficient electricity transfer over long distances with minimal losses. They ensure reliable insulation and connection between different voltage levels in HVDC transmission systems. For Renewable Energy Integration, these bushings enable the smooth integration of renewable energy sources like wind and solar power into the grid, supporting stable and sustainable energy distribution.In the Oil & Gas sector, HVDC wall bushings are utilized in offshore platforms and onshore facilities to ensure safe and reliable power supply, crucial for operational continuity and safety. For Grid Access in Remote Areas, these components are essential in extending the reach of electricity to remote and isolated regions, providing reliable power access where traditional AC transmission lines may not be feasible. Lastly, in Cross
-border Power Interconnection projects, HVDC wall bushings are integral to connecting power grids between different countries, facilitating international energy exchange and improving overall grid stability and efficiency.This market segmentation reflects the diverse applications of HVDC wall bushings in enhancing energy infrastructure across North America, driven by the need for efficient power transmission, renewable energy integration, and reliable grid connectivity in both urban and remote areas.
